The Language of 2025 South Africa’s social feeds in 2025 are buzzing with new words and digital inside jokes. Slang like delulu, rizz, and…
A computer or a 13 year old boy? Judges left baffled
If you have even a passing familiarity with technology, you’ve probably at least heard of the Turing test. You’ll understand that it’s pretty exciting…